Institute of Tropical Medicine: Admissions, Rankings
Inaugurated over a century ago, the Institute of Tropical Medicine is dedicated to the educational and scientific development of public health and tropical medicine in Belgium. It started as a training school for nurses and doctors in Congo and has now evolved into a global frontrunner in medical education, research, and service. With excellence as one of its core values, the university provides outstanding and accessible healthcare services, especially for concerns about sexually transmitted infections and HIV.

Tuition Fees at Institute of Tropical Medicine
Institute of Tropical Medicine tuition fees for master's students are discussed in this section.
Master's Tuition Fees
Student Type | Annual Tuition Fees in Euros |
---|---|
Domestic Students | 5,460 Euros |
International Students | 16,500 Euros |
Although this range provide a good estimate of tuition costs at Institute of Tropical Medicine, the actual fees depend on your chosen program. Thus, for more exact figures, you may refer to Institute of Tropical Medicine tuition fee pages.

Language Requirements at Institute of Tropical Medicine
If you wish to be a Institute of Tropical Medicine international student, you’d wonder if you need to speak or write the native language of Belgium before you can study in the institution. That depends on what language requirements they ask from you.
For Institute of Tropical Medicine, these are the language requirements or test scores that you need to submit:
English Language Requirements
Proficiency in English is typically required for admission and successful completion of academic programs in Belgium. For Institute of Tropical Medicine, they may accept scores of these English language tests as proof of proficiency:
- IELTS
- TOEFL
These are the minimum scores required for master’s students:
Degree | IELTS | TOEFL |
---|---|---|
Master’s | 6.5 | 88 |
Specific scores may vary depending on your program. Make sure to check out the language pages of Institute of Tropical Medicine to know more about the required scores.
